In modern industry, the performance of boiler pipelines directly affects the efficiency and safety of the entire system. Therefore, choosing the appropriate surface coating material is of vital importance. In recent years, arc-sprayed PS45 material coatings have attracted extensive attention due to their superior performance. This article will explore why arc-sprayed PS45 material coating is chosen for boiler pipes, as well as the advantages and improvement space it brings.
The arc-sprayed PS45 material coating has excellent wear resistance and corrosion resistance, which can effectively extend the service life of boiler pipes. Boiler pipes operate in high-temperature and high-pressure environments, making them prone to corrosion and wear. However, the PS45 coating can form a strong protective film, reducing the occurrence of these problems. In addition, this coating has strong adhesion and can form a good bond with the surface of boiler pipes, ensuring long-term stable performance.
